Saprotrophic nutrition (pronounced /sæprɵˈtrɒfɪk/) is a process of chemoheterotrophic extra-cellular digestion involved in the processing of dead or decayed organic matter which occurs in saprotrophs or heterotrophs, and is most often associated with fungi for example, the Mucor and Rhizopus. The process is most often facilitated through the active transport of such materials through endocytosis within the internal mycelium and its constituent hyphae.[1]
